The only reason that poeple complain about KB Hypereutetic pistons is they didn't follow the instructions for end gap and break a piston when the ring ends hit or because the instructions say to set them much wider they assume there will be more leak down. Because the ring is closer to the top of the piston it runs hotter which requires more end gap to prevent them from hitting. At temperture the gap is no different than any other piston.
